
Liberty Mutual Partners Ethos to Expand Digital Life Insurance Offering
Companies Mentioned
Why It Matters
The alliance accelerates Liberty Mutual’s digital transformation, tapping into growing consumer demand for fast, exam‑free life coverage and positioning the firm ahead of competitors in the online insurance space.
Key Takeaways
- •Liberty Mutual adopts Ethos underwriting engine for instant online policies.
- •No medical exam required; customers answer few health questions.
- •Offering launches on Liberty Mutual website and partner channels.
- •Partnership exemplifies insurers' shift to embedded digital platforms.
- •Expected to broaden life insurance accessibility and attract younger demographics.
Pulse Analysis
Liberty Mutual’s collaboration with Ethos marks a strategic leap into the digital life‑insurance arena, marrying a trusted brand with a proven technology stack. Ethos’s platform automates risk assessment, delivering instant policy decisions after a brief health questionnaire, eliminating the traditional medical exam bottleneck. By embedding this capability within Liberty Mutual’s own digital channels, the insurer can offer a seamless, white‑label experience that retains brand equity while meeting the expectations of a tech‑savvy consumer base.
The partnership underscores a wider industry migration toward embedded insurance solutions and automated underwriting. Insurers are increasingly adopting plug‑and‑play platforms to reduce acquisition costs, speed time‑to‑market, and capture younger demographics who prefer self‑service models. Ethos, already a leader in digital life insurance, provides a scalable engine that can be integrated across multiple carriers, fostering a competitive ecosystem where technology, rather than legacy processes, drives growth. This trend is reshaping distribution, with insurers leveraging partner ecosystems and online channels to reach customers beyond traditional agents.
For Liberty Mutual, the deal promises to expand its market share in the direct‑to‑consumer segment and diversify its product portfolio. Instant, exam‑free policies can attract first‑time buyers and those seeking supplemental coverage, potentially boosting premium volume and cross‑sell opportunities. Moreover, the digital rollout aligns with regulatory trends favoring transparency and consumer protection, as streamlined applications reduce errors and improve data accuracy. As the partnership matures, Liberty Mutual may explore additional digital products, cementing its position as a forward‑looking insurer in an increasingly digital marketplace.
